How Whirlpool refrigerator problems usually show up
Most household refrigerator failures begin with one noticeable change: food does not stay as cold, ice cream softens, vegetables freeze, water appears under drawers, or the machine starts clicking and humming differently. Those clues matter because they help narrow the problem to a specific system.
On many Whirlpool refrigerators, the most common trouble areas involve airflow between compartments, evaporator or condenser fan operation, defrost components, door sealing, temperature sensing, control boards, drain blockages, and in some cases the sealed system. A proper diagnosis separates a repairable part failure from a more expensive cooling-system issue.
Fresh-food section is warm but freezer still seems cold
This often points to an airflow or defrost problem rather than a complete loss of refrigeration. Cold air may not be moving correctly from the freezer into the refrigerator compartment because of frost buildup, a failing evaporator fan, a stuck damper, or blocked vents. Homeowners sometimes lower the temperature setting to compensate, but that usually does not solve the underlying issue.
Freezer is softening or both sections are warming
When both compartments lose temperature, the problem may be broader. Dirty condenser coils, fan failure, control issues, compressor start trouble, or sealed-system problems can all reduce cooling performance. If frozen items are beginning to thaw, service should be treated as time-sensitive.
Food is freezing in the refrigerator compartment
If drinks turn slushy, produce freezes, or items near one vent become icy, the refrigerator may be overcooling in certain zones. This can happen when a thermistor gives incorrect readings, a damper stays open too long, airflow becomes uneven, or the control system does not regulate temperature properly. Freezing in one section does not always mean the whole refrigerator is “too cold”; it often means cooling is being distributed incorrectly.
Water inside the refrigerator or on the floor
A blocked defrost drain is a common cause of interior water and puddling beneath the appliance. Water supply connections for an ice maker or dispenser can also leak, and damaged door gaskets may create excess condensation. Even a small recurring leak deserves attention because it can damage flooring, baseboards, and nearby cabinetry over time.
Frost on panels, shelves, or around the freezer door
Frost buildup usually means warm, moist air is getting in or the refrigerator is not defrosting as it should. A torn gasket, misaligned door, defrost heater problem, failed thermostat, or control issue can all contribute. Once frost builds up around vents or evaporator covers, airflow drops and cooling complaints usually follow.
Clicking, buzzing, rattling, or unusually loud operation
Some sound is normal, especially during startup, defrost cycles, or ice maker operation. What matters is a change from the refrigerator’s usual pattern. Repeated clicking without normal cooling can suggest a compressor start issue. A loud whirring noise may point to a fan blade hitting ice or a worn fan motor. Rattling can come from loose panels, drain pans, or vibration that developed after the refrigerator was moved.
Signs the issue may be getting worse
Small changes often become more obvious over a few days. A refrigerator that starts by running slightly warm can end up losing food-safe temperatures entirely. Watch for these signs that the fault is progressing:
- Longer run times with less consistent cooling
- Frost returning quickly after being cleared
- Temperature swings from one day to the next
- Water pooling repeatedly in the same area
- New noises followed by weaker cooling performance
- Doors that no longer seem to seal tightly
These patterns often indicate that the refrigerator is working harder while delivering worse results, which can put more strain on fans, controls, and the cooling system.

Why symptom-based diagnosis matters
Two Whirlpool refrigerators can both seem “not cold enough” for completely different reasons. One may have a simple fan problem, while another has a defrost failure or a sealed-system issue. Replacing parts based on guesswork can waste time and money, especially when the visible symptom is only the result of a deeper fault.
That is why the most useful service approach starts with how the refrigerator behaves in real use: whether one section fails before the other, whether frost appears in a specific area, whether noise happens at startup or during normal operation, and whether the issue is constant or intermittent. Those details help identify the failed system and whether repair is likely to restore normal daily use.
Repair or replacement: what usually makes sense
Many Whirlpool refrigerator problems are worth repairing, especially when the issue involves common components such as fan motors, thermostats, thermistors, switches, defrost parts, drains, gaskets, or controls. These faults can often be resolved without replacing the appliance.
Replacement becomes more likely when the refrigerator has major sealed-system trouble, repeated breakdowns, or overall wear that makes another repair hard to justify. Age matters, but it is not the only factor. A newer unit with a localized part failure may be a strong repair candidate, while an older refrigerator with multiple performance issues may not be.
A realistic decision usually comes down to:
- Which system has failed
- Whether other components were affected by the same problem
- The condition of the refrigerator overall
- Whether the repair is likely to bring back stable, reliable operation
What to check before the technician arrives
A few observations can make diagnosis faster and more accurate. Before service, note whether the problem affects the freezer, the fresh-food section, or both. It also helps to pay attention to whether the issue is constant or comes and goes.
- Check for frost on the back freezer panel or around door openings
- Notice whether interior fans can be heard running
- Look for water under crisper drawers or beneath the unit
- Make note of any recent power outage or breaker trip
- See whether the ice maker or water dispenser is also acting up
- Listen for clicking, buzzing, or scraping sounds and when they occur
You do not need to disassemble anything, but these details can help connect the symptom to the right system more quickly.
